2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案_第1頁
2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案_第2頁
2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案_第3頁
2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案_第4頁
2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案_第5頁
已閱讀5頁,還剩1頁未讀 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

2025年中職移動應(yīng)用開發(fā)(APP開發(fā)基礎(chǔ))試題及答案

(考試時間:90分鐘滿分100分)班級______姓名______第I卷(選擇題共40分)(總共8題,每題5分,每題只有一個正確答案,請將正確答案填寫在答題紙上)1.以下哪種編程語言常用于移動應(yīng)用開發(fā)的后端服務(wù)?A.JavaB.SwiftC.PythonD.Kotlin2.在移動應(yīng)用開發(fā)中,用于存儲應(yīng)用數(shù)據(jù)的是?A.數(shù)據(jù)庫管理系統(tǒng)B.版本控制系統(tǒng)C.網(wǎng)絡(luò)服務(wù)器D.編譯器3.移動應(yīng)用開發(fā)中,UI設(shè)計的核心原則不包括?A.簡潔性B.一致性C.復(fù)雜性D.易用性4.以下哪個不是常見的移動應(yīng)用開發(fā)框架?A.ReactNativeB.FlutterC.AngularD.AndroidStudio5.移動應(yīng)用開發(fā)中,處理用戶輸入的最佳方式是?A.直接在界面中修改數(shù)據(jù)B.通過事件監(jiān)聽獲取輸入并處理C.忽略用戶輸入D.在后臺自動處理6.要實(shí)現(xiàn)移動應(yīng)用的推送通知功能,需要使用?A.圖形處理庫B.地圖APIC.推送服務(wù)提供商D.音頻播放庫7.移動應(yīng)用開發(fā)中,優(yōu)化應(yīng)用性能的措施不包括?A.減少代碼冗余B.增加復(fù)雜動畫C.優(yōu)化圖片資源D.合理管理內(nèi)存8.以下哪種測試是移動應(yīng)用開發(fā)中必不可少的?A.單元測試B.壓力測試C.兼容性測試D.以上都是第II卷(非選擇題共60分)簡答題(共20分)(總共2題,每題10分,請簡要回答問題)9.簡述移動應(yīng)用開發(fā)中前端開發(fā)和后端開發(fā)的主要任務(wù)分別是什么?10.說明在移動應(yīng)用開發(fā)中選擇合適開發(fā)工具的重要性以及需要考慮的因素。程序設(shè)計題(共20分)(總共1題,每題20分,請根據(jù)要求編寫代碼)11.請用你熟悉的編程語言編寫一個簡單的函數(shù),用于計算兩個整數(shù)的和,并返回結(jié)果。案例分析題(共10分)(總共1題,每題10分,請閱讀案例并回答問題)12.某移動應(yīng)用在發(fā)布后,用戶反饋在特定手機(jī)型號上出現(xiàn)卡頓現(xiàn)象。請分析可能導(dǎo)致這種情況的原因,并提出至少兩種解決辦法。綜合應(yīng)用題(共10分)(總共1題,每題10分,請結(jié)合所學(xué)知識完成應(yīng)用)13.設(shè)計一個簡單的移動應(yīng)用功能,比如一個待辦事項列表。描述其主要功能模塊、界面設(shè)計思路以及涉及的技術(shù)要點(diǎn)。答案:1.C2.A3.C4.D5.B6.C7.B8.D9.前端開發(fā)主要任務(wù)包括設(shè)計用戶界面,實(shí)現(xiàn)頁面布局、交互效果等,注重用戶體驗和視覺呈現(xiàn)。后端開發(fā)主要負(fù)責(zé)處理業(yè)務(wù)邏輯和數(shù)據(jù)存儲、讀取等,如與數(shù)據(jù)庫交互,提供接口給前端調(diào)用,保障應(yīng)用數(shù)據(jù)的完整性和業(yè)務(wù)流程的正常運(yùn)行。10.合適的開發(fā)工具能提高開發(fā)效率、保證代碼質(zhì)量等。需考慮工具對目標(biāo)平臺的支持,如是否適配iOS或Android;是否有豐富的插件和社區(qū)支持以便獲取資源;工具的學(xué)習(xí)成本和易用性;性能表現(xiàn),能否高效處理代碼和資源;與團(tuán)隊現(xiàn)有技術(shù)棧的兼容性等。11.示例代碼(以Python為例):```pythondefadd_numbers(a,b):returna+b```12.可能原因:該手機(jī)型號硬件性能較低,應(yīng)用對其硬件資源消耗過大;代碼存在性能問題,如大量循環(huán)未優(yōu)化、內(nèi)存管理不當(dāng)?shù)取=鉀Q辦法:優(yōu)化代碼,減少不必要的計算和內(nèi)存占用;對不同手機(jī)型號進(jìn)行針對性的性能測試和優(yōu)化,調(diào)整應(yīng)用資源加載策略等。13.主要功能模塊:可添加待辦事項,記錄事項內(nèi)容、時間等;能對事項進(jìn)行標(biāo)記完成、刪除等操作。界面設(shè)計思路:采用

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論